For Summer 2023, the Wild Nephin National Park will organise special Guided Walks and the Wild Child Clubs for Kids.

Here is the programme of events for July and August and it caters for all ages.

Wild Child Clubs

Wild Child Clubs will run every Tuesday and Thursday in July and August at 2.30 pm in Ballicroy Visitor Centre.

The kids' clubs will cover topics such as animal adaptations, wildflower workshops, myths surrounding biodiversity and seashore ecology.

Pollinator and Wildflowers Workshops

Workshops will run n July 8th & August 12th at Ballycroy Visitor Centre at 12 noon.

Participants will learn about pollinator diversity & the wildflowers they feed on, and how to identify & record them.

International Bog Day

The event is scheduled to occur for a duration of two days.

On July 22nd, there will be the “Brilliance of our Bogs”. Participants will learn about the beautiful wildflowers and plants of Mayo’s bogs.

On July 23rd, the “Bog Walk with Wild Atlantic Nature.”

Meadow Making and Seed Collecting

It will run from August 26th to August 27th at Ballycroy Visitor Centre.

Participants will discover how to harvest different types of seeds and make their own meadow.
